Mr. Bruce Travers, interning guidance counselor, taught perseverance and patience using a bird nest lesson at Showell Elementary School. Showell’s second grade students observed a real bird nest, then discussed the importance of creating a safe environment to live in. Students went outside and collected twigs, leaves, paper and weeds. They glued the materials to form a nest. Then Mr. Travers used the activity to talk about creative problem solving by building a nest with found materials. They talked about how it took commitment and perseverance to finish the task. Students related the activity to building friendships and how each one looks different and has different qualities.
